The differences between senior gis analysts and senior sap consultants can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 4-6 years to become both a senior gis analyst and a senior sap consultant. Additionally, a senior sap consultant has an average salary of $106,438, which is higher than the $78,218 average annual salary of a senior gis analyst.
The top three skills for a senior gis analyst include python, geospatial and esri. The most important skills for a senior sap consultant are prototyping, virtualization, and sap hana.

A senior GIS analyst specializes in utilizing geographic information systems and tools in analyzing spatial data and conducting research and assessments. Through their research findings, a senior GIS analyst can help companies make significant decisions and help solve potential or existing issues. Being a senior GIS analyst with years of experience, they also have the ability to train and supervise junior analysts, design and implement GIS software, spearhead and oversee projects, and conduct regular inspections to ensure procedures adhere to standards and regulations.
Senior SAP consultants are information technology (IT) management professionals who are responsible for selling business software and hardware products from an SAP (systems, applications, and products) company. These consultants must conduct meetings with clients to extract their business requirements and perform a gap analysis to develop optimum business solutions. They must work with the support personnel from other modules to provide a solution for all their SAP issues. Senior SAP consultants must also provide training and prepare training materials for end-users in SAP-FI modules.
